SUMMARY:Ohio Collage Society Member's Exhibition
DESCRIPTION:The Coburn Art Gallery at Ashland University is hosting a regio
 nal exhibition that will feature 70 captivating works by members of the Ohi
 o Collage Society from Friday\, May 29\, through Friday\, July 24. The free
  opening reception will be on May 29 from 6-7:30 p.m.The exhibition highlig
 hts a wide variety of collage technique\, including both two-dimensional an
 d three-dimensional forms that explore diverse materials and creative appro
 aches. Collage\, the art of assembling disparate materials to create a new 
 whole\, can be traced back to 200 B.C. and was named in the 20th century by
  artists Pablo Picasso and Georges Braque. It was derived from the French w
 ord coller\, meaning to glue.Featured artists in the exhibition include Ani
 ta Burgess\, Nancy S. Sotka\, Mary Ann Sedivy\, Cynthia Petry\, Gwen Waight
 \, Brenda Schneider\, Helen Wilson\, Karen Koch\, Shirley Ende-Saxe\, Care 
 Hanson\, Patricia Schroeder\, JoAnn Giordano\, Gail Taber\, Clare Murray Ad
 ams and Alexander Aitken.The Ohio Collage Society\, established in 2007\, w
 as founded by Gretchen Bierbaum\, who is also the founder of the National C
 ollage Society. Its 53 members exhibit a broad range of contemporary styles
  and ideas\, fostering appreciation\, production and visibility of this uni
 que art form by promoting it both in Ohio and nationally.The Coburn Gallery
 ’s summer hours are Tuesday through Friday 10 a.m.-4 p.m.\, as well as Sa
 turday noon-4 p.m. It is free and open to the public. For more information 
 about the exhibition\, call 419-289-5652 or visit the gallery’s Facebook
  page.
